Avocets at Topsham
Taken from Goat Walk, Avocets are important to the area bringing in lots of bird-watchers. The nearby railway line is called "The Avocet Line". They are very delicate looking birds and sway from side to side inserting their bill tips in the mud detecting prey by touch.
